在Mac上使用Shadowsocks和kcptun的完整指南

在现代网络环境中,Shadowsockskcptun是两种非常受欢迎的工具,它们帮助用户突破网络限制,保护个人隐私。在本指南中,我们将详细介绍如何在Mac上使用Shadowsockskcptun,以便您能够顺利配置和使用它们。

什么是Shadowsocks?

Shadowsocks是一种代理工具,旨在保护用户的隐私并提高网络安全性。它能够绕过各种网络审查,适合在受限网络环境中使用。Shadowsocks的优势包括:

  • 速度快:由于其高效的传输协议,Shadowsocks通常比传统VPN速度更快。
  • 易于配置:使用Shadowsocks的配置文件,用户可以轻松完成设置。
  • 跨平台支持:Shadowsocks支持多种操作系统,包括Windows、Mac、Linux等。

什么是kcptun?

kcptun是一个用于优化Shadowsocks连接的插件,能够提高网络传输效率。它通过使用KCP协议来减少延迟,提高数据传输的稳定性。kcptun的优点包括:

  • 降低延迟:使用kcptun后,网络连接的延迟显著减少。
  • 抗丢包:即使在不稳定的网络环境中,kcptun也能提供较好的连接质量。

在Mac上安装Shadowsocks

第一步:下载Shadowsocks客户端

  1. 打开浏览器,访问Shadowsocks的GitHub页面。
  2. 找到Mac版本的客户端下载链接并下载。
  3. 解压下载的文件,将Shadowsocks拖到应用程序文件夹中。

第二步:配置Shadowsocks

  1. 启动Shadowsocks客户端。
  2. 在菜单栏中点击Shadowsocks图标,选择“服务器设置”。
  3. 输入您的服务器信息,包括IP地址、端口号、密码和加密方式。
  4. 点击“确定”保存设置。

在Mac上安装kcptun

第一步:下载kcptun客户端

  1. 在浏览器中搜索kcptun并访问其GitHub页面。
  2. 下载适合Mac的客户端版本。
  3. 解压下载的文件。

第二步:配置kcptun

  1. 打开终端,进入到kcptun的解压文件夹。

  2. 使用以下命令启动kcptun:
    bash
    ./kcptun -r 服务器地址:端口 -l :本地端口

  3. 替换命令中的服务器地址、端口和本地端口为您的实际信息。

  4. 确认kcptun已经成功运行。

将kcptun与Shadowsocks结合使用

  1. 在Shadowsocks客户端的服务器设置中,将服务器地址更改为kcptun本地端口(如:127.0.0.1:本地端口)。
  2. 重新连接Shadowsocks,以确保它通过kcptun进行连接。
  3. 检查网络连接,确认一切正常。

常见问题解答

Q1:Shadowsocks和kcptun的区别是什么?

A1:Shadowsocks是一个代理工具,而kcptun是一个优化Shadowsocks连接的插件。使用kcptun可以提高Shadowsocks的连接质量和速度。

Q2:如何解决Shadowsocks无法连接的问题?

A2:可以尝试以下方法:

  • 检查您的服务器信息是否正确。
  • 确认网络是否稳定。
  • 尝试更换不同的加密方式或端口。

Q3:使用kcptun后真的能提高速度吗?

A3:根据用户反馈,在不稳定的网络环境下,使用kcptun后延迟通常会显著降低,从而提升网络体验。

Q4:我可以在iOS或Android上使用Shadowsocks吗?

A4:是的,Shadowsocks也有适用于iOS和Android的客户端,您可以在应用商店中搜索下载。

结论

通过本文的详细介绍,相信您已经掌握了如何在Mac上安装和使用Shadowsocks及kcptun。利用这两个工具,您可以更安全、更流畅地上网,享受更加自由的网络体验。

正文完